Marilin “Piddle” Nowlin Kelley, age 81, of Frisco, Texas, passed away on June 6, 2020. She was born on October 17, 1938, in Sherman, Texas, to T. R. and Stella Camp Nowlin and graduated from Sherman High School in 1957. Piddle attended The University of Texas at Austin for three years, then graduated from East Texas State with a degree in Education in 1961, specializing in Speech and Hearing Therapy. She married her husband Jeff Kelley on June 24, 1961, in Sherman, Texas, where they had two children, Jeff and Kristen, and lived for several years before moving to Austin, Texas. They also spent time living in Lexington, Kentucky, Overland Park, Kansas, and Ridgefield, Connecticut, where she worked as a realtor before their family returned to Plano, Texas, in 1986 and lived for 32 years before moving to Frisco in 2018. Once back in Texas, Piddle spent her time volunteering with the Assistance League of Dallas and entertaining her kids’ college friends. She later became the best grandmother to her beloved grandchildren who affectionately called her “Pio.”
Piddle will be deeply missed by all who knew her and her fun-loving nature and sweet disposition. She was a true lady.
